Re: Jag Speedo Sensor

'I must admit that I'm not familiar with a speedo sensor going in the diff'

FYI : XJS, cast Al cover, below the breather. 10 pulses per wheel rev, picked up from either a machined 'castlation' on the RH half of the PL unit or from the later, cost reduced, pressed on steel version of the same.

Pick-up is the same as the one used on XJ40 - but on XJ40 it mounts to a cast Al bracket which positions it to pick up off a pressed ring mounted on the (LH?) output shaft.
